Certification

Highest quality and safety from HWM - Certified quality management

Safety is our top priority. Our systems are used in sensitive and safety-critical areas where the protection of people and systems has the highest priority.

This aspiration drives us and motivates us to deliver top technical performance. Our goal of remaining the market leader in terms of quality requires the consistent focus of all processes on quality, functional reliability and standard-compliant procedures.

Based on our vision and mission, we do not process orders for nuclear military operations. Instead, we focus on research, maintenance and the continuous development of safety and emergency concepts with our products.

Our quality management system has been certified in accordance with DIN EN ISO 9001:2015 and KTA 1401 for many years. Our environmental management system is also certified in accordance with DIN EN ISO 14001:2015.

Occupational health and safety is also firmly anchored in our processes. The requirements of DIN ISO 45001:2018 are integrated into our occupational health and safety management system.

For our customers, this means certified, traceable and legally compliant processes. We demonstrably fulfill the relevant criteria, particularly in the area of ATEX, and thus make an important contribution to the safety of people and systems.

Our history

More than 70 years of development and experience

1946 Foundation

Foundation of the sole proprietorship Hans Wälischmiller in Meersburg. Development of dental devices for the medical market.

1950 Entry into the nuclear industry

The order for the construction and delivery of a system for decanting, distributing and packaging radioactive Sr90 marks the start of production in nuclear medicine.

1962 Company headquarters in Markdorf

Relocation of the company headquarters and production from Meersburg to Markdorf.

1963 Delivery of the first A100 manipulator

Delivery of the A100 manipulators to the Karlsruhe Nuclear Research Center. It makes the operator's work easier and therefore safer, more precise and faster.

1966 Delivery of the first A200 manipulator

Delivery of the first A200 articulated manipulators to Forschungszentrum Jülich.

1979 Development of the A1000 power manipulator

Development of the A1000 power manipulator for remote-controlled handling of heavy loads.

1990 Equipment development for reactor dismantling

Development of watertight equipment and tools for the dismantling of decommissioned reactors.

1995 Development of the TELBOT® robotic arm

Delivery of the first TELBOT® handling robot to AECL - Atomic Energy of Canada

1995 ISO 9001 certification

First certification. Since then, Wälischmiller Engineering has been fully ISO 9001 certified.

1998 the "blue hall" - symbole of HWM in Markdorf

The "large hall" with a height of 15 meters and a water basin with a depth of 5 meters is completed in Markdorf. Power manipulators with extremely long telescopes can now be tested in a fully extended state - even under water.

2006 New certification KTA1401

First and since then continuous certification according to KTA1401. In 2025, the KTA certification was supplemented with certification according to 19443 and distinguishes HWM as a reliable supplier in the nuclear industry.

2010 Wälischmiller Engineering GmbH

Sale of Hans Wälischmiller GmbH to Carr's Milling Industries plc. in Carlisle, Great Britain. Under the new name WÄLISCHMILLER ENGINEERING GMBH, products for the nuclear industry are now planned and manufactured at the Markdorf site with 125 employees.

2012 Delivery of the first arm type A1000S

The A1000S robot arm impresses with its high loads, 3D simulation, programmability and high quality.

2013 Development of the V1000 vehicle

The chain-driven V1000 manipulator vehicle makes the high-quality A1000 manipulator arm mobile!

2014 New company building

The new, state-of-the-art company building was completed in 2014. After two challenging years, Wälischmiller Engineering GmbH has now a modern administration building and a production environment with optimized workflows and efficiently designed processes.

The Te.I.D. system specially developed for the TELBOT® was also successfully delivered in 2014.

2015 ATEX

First ATEX certification for the newly developed TELBOT® robot arm (Demo 2000 and Z0) for use in explosive environments

2016 Growth & environmental standard

Expansion through the takeover of a supplier company in Bermatingen. In the same year, the company was certified to ISO 14001 for the first time, and the environmental management system has been maintained continuously and without interruption ever since.

2017 Delivery of the first drum gripper

This manipulator is used for handling drums, for example in drum storage facilities for radioactive waste.

2018 Building extension

Completion of the extension and relocation of the newly acquired company from Bermatingen to Markdorf.

2019 Delivery of the modern double-arm TELBOT®

Combination of two TELBOT® robot arms. The solution has already been used in several projects, including the decommissioning of the Rheinsberg and Greifswald nuclear power plants in northern Germany at the end of the 1990s.

2023 Development of LIROB

The LIROB robotic arm was specially developed for nuclear medicine. It is installed in an 8-inch wall tube and can handle objects weighing up to 10 kg.

2025 Cadre Holdings

Since 2025, Wälischmiller Engineering GmbH, together with Alpha Safety, NFT, Bendalls and NuVision, has been part of the Nuclear Engineering division of Cadre Holding.
